How the UK plans to stand out Page: https://stenobird.com/podcast/the-long-short-4366180/129-how-the-uk-plans-to-stand-out Text version: https://stenobird.com/podcast/the-long-short-4366180/129-how-the-uk-plans-to-stand-out.md Podcast: [The Long-Short](https://stenobird.com/podcast/the-long-short-4366180) Published: 2026-04-22T15:21:50+00:00 Episode link: https://shows.acast.com/the-long-short/episodes/129-how-the-uk-plans-to-stand-out Audio file: https://sphinx.acast.com/p/open/s/636b781f4a382300110bb134/e/69e8e78fabe143da5b906638/media.mp3 Processing state: not_requested JSON: https://stenobird.com/v1/public/podcasts/the-long-short-4366180/episodes/129-how-the-uk-plans-to-stand-out Duration seconds: 1422 ## Resource The UK has already seen a significant push of regulatory reform affecting alternative investments this year, with much more still to come. Aniqah Rao, Associate Director of Markets, Governance and Innovation at AIMA, joins The Long-Short to analyse last week’s FCA publication on short selling, the ongoing consultation around a potential ban on non-competes and highlight the key proposals that should be on your radar for the rest of 2026.
